TeamGroup T-Create CinemaPr P31 Portable External SSD
TeamGroup T-Create CinemaPr P31 Kicks Off A New Lineup of Products

TeamGroup has proudly introduced the T-Create CinemaPr P31 External SSD as part of this series. Designed for professionals, this portable SSD is easy to use with smartphones, DSLR cameras, and more.

TeamGroup’s patented design keeps installation seamless, while USB Type-C support offers up to 2000MB/s transfer speed support. In short, the CinemaPr P31 is your ticket to unlocking a new realm of possibilities, whether it be for video recording or simply capturing lifelike pictures.

Weighing just 97g, the SSD is a breeze to carry. However, it does not compromise build quality, coming with an aluminum alloy enclosure. Meanwhile, a maximum of 4TB storage capacity ensures the TeamGroup T-Create CinemaPR P31 can store up to 400 minutes of 8K RAW files.

These features are just scratching the surface when it comes to everything the CinemaPr P31 has to offer. TeamGroup has confirmed a release for mid-April, and you can learn more about specifics over on the official website.
